I'm just wondering, is anyone else watching A History Of Scotland on BBC1? I've just finished watching the 2nd episode and I have to say I've found it terrific.
The first episode starts with Roman invasions, Viking raiders through to King McAlpine and on to his grandson King Constantine and the fusion of the Gaelic & Pictish races of Scotland to form the Kingdom of Alba, the Northern Alliance with the Vikings & Iceland, and then inevitably the repulsion of the first English invasion in 987.
Thats alot to cram in to 60 minutes! it is presented by
Neil Olliver who does a very good job of things.
